The Final Mill: Uses & Recommended Methods
Knowing a 1 end mill is essential for producing accurate finishes in diverse metalworking applications . These adaptable tools are frequently utilized for slotting components, carving designs, and creating intricate features . To guarantee performance and optimal material removal capabilities, always follow these key guidelines: select the appropriate end mill type (e.g., square, ball nose, stub) based on the material and feature being produced; maintain proper feed rates and depths of cut; employ sufficient cooling lubrication to minimize heat and extend tool life; and regularly inspect the cutting edges for wear and damage. Proper handling and storage are also important factors.

Understanding End Mill Geometry for Optimal Grooving
To gain optimal grooving performance, a detailed understanding of end tool geometry is vital. The channel angle, usually ranging from 30 to 45 degrees, significantly influences chip removal and quality. A reduced angle supplies more contact for increased cuts, while a steeper angle promotes better waste evacuation and minimizes congestion. Furthermore, the point geometry – including the rake and relief angles – straight impacts cutting load and surface. Selecting the appropriate end mill for the defined grooving task is necessary for enhancing efficiency and increasing blade longevity. Evaluate these factors to ensure effective grooving.
